Los Angeles Intensive - Sunday Morning Backbends
This Sunday Morning session challenges you with two hours of Inversions and Backbends including Vrksikasana and Urdhva Dhanurasana followed by one hour of Restorative and Pranayama with an introduction to Anuloma Pranayama and Nadi Shodana Pranayama. All Lois' classes are taught in the Iyengar Tradition and the Advanced Classes are appropriate for students with several years study in Iyengar Yoga. Halasana![]() |
English name: Plow Pose Practice type: Inversions Practice level: Intermediate Learn to maintain the lift of the spine when the toes touch the floor. Extend the hips towards the ceiling. Lift the backs of the knees. Press the Toes to Lift the Thighs, the Buttocks and the Trunk. |
